If you go through Idaho Falls, head east out of town and take 26 past Palisades Reservoir. That puts you on 89 through the western edge of Wyoming. It's pretty good. Once you get near Bear Lake, resist the urge to take in a lot of lakeside scenery. The traffic stinks. So once you get to Ovid, give 36 a try. I've never ridden it, but it goes through mountains, and it's got to be better than the slog down the west side of Bear Lake.

If you have time around Salt Lake City, head east and ride route 150 through Wasatch-Cache National Forest. Great road, through fantastic scenery.
